Do you ever find yourself getting into arguments or disagreements that you later regret? Sometimes we fight because we just what to be "right" and often it isn't worth the collateral damage, energy, and stress that those conflicts or worse yet, fights can create. Not all conflict is bad of course! Constructive disagreements can be really beneficial for your relationships at home, work and with friends. It is the destruction conflicts, the disagreements or arguments that serve no purpose that chip away at our relationships that make us less happy, less fulfilled and more alone. In this episode, I discuss the mantra that I use that [when I use it - I am working on it] helps me make sure that the conflicts I do have are worth fighting for and that I pick my battles better. Somethings in life are worth dying for, some are not worth a second of our time, I hope this episode helps you make better and more thoughtful decisions on a daily basis about which are which and make your relationships better, happier and more fulfilling.
